Yesterday, it was Iker Casillas who came to report on their personal situation. Today it is the turn of Cristiano Ronaldo. For the Portuguese, 2012 will be a busy year in emotions towards the Avenida Concha Espina between his first title of champion of Spain, the beginning of the season of his complicated, his statements about his contract extension and the struggle for the FIFA Ballon d’Or, CR7 regaled the media.

At a press conference, the No. 7 merengue has reviewed all their news. Starting with his relationship with his fans. “I feel great, I am convinced that this season may be better than last year. As always, I hope to give the best of myself and be stronger than last season. I feel good with the fans, and not just inside the stadium. They give me a lot of affection.” He hopes to be displayed translate on the ground in other major trophies won. For Cristiano Ronaldo, there is that’s what counts and not his contract extension.

“This case has already been mentioned. I will speak of my extension. This is not the most important. What is, is to win the next matches. We will fight to the end for the championship, for cutting the King and the Champions League. “ Determined not to fuel the controversy about it, the Spaniard also spoke of the support of the FIFA Ballon d’Or in which his eternal rival Lionel Messi was announced as the favourite. “I’m sincere and I’m sure to win the FIFA Ballon d’Or, but if I do not win, it does not matter. Last season, we won La Liga and the Supercopa of Spain so if I do not win, it’s nothing. ‘

Manchester United team the club he attended from 2003 to 2009 and he will face in the knockout stages of the Champions League. Reunion looming moving, even if it is no question of feelings on the ground. “It is always a feeling of friendship and affection. This is a team that has marked my career. People know me there, I have many friends. They are in my heart. But now I defend the colours of Real Madrid. I’m a little sad, but I want to win and give my best score.” Finally, CR7 gave his perspective on the other big hot topic of Real Madrid: the future of his coach Jose Mourinho.“Well, I do not know. It depends on the situation and the club. I love it because it is the appropriate coach. A top coach for a top club. I think he will stay, but everyone chooses what will happen the future.’
